The main goal of the press is to force the ball to be inbounded to the strong-side corner and then immediately trap the offensive player that catches the basketball using the inbounder and the closest wing player.This is the main trap of the press and the goal is to force the trapped offensive player to throw a lob pass over top of the trap and have it picked off by one of the defensive interceptors.While this is the main goal, there are ma… In this example One (1) would form a secondary trap with Four (4). X5 drops back as the safety in the middle, deep to prevent the long diagonal pass. 2.5.1. We have the ball-side deep player X4 move to the sideline to deny the pass up the sideline, while X5 denies the pass to the middle. Gestion. Defenders must keep the arms and hands extended and shift while the ball is in the air on all passes. Each time the ball is reversed, the defenders must give up some ground and move backward some so that X1 will have a better angle to trap. The main difference between the 1-2-2 zone defense and the 3-2 zone is how the top defender plays when the basketball is at the top of the key. As the ball is reversed to the opposite sideline, X3 now prevents the sideline dribble penetration, X1 sprints over to trap and X2 denies the middle pass. While the 1-2-1-1 traps the ballhandler on the initial inbounded pass, the 2-2-1 press usually is more passive and waits for the ballhandler to start his dribble down the sideline before trapping him. In a 1-2-2 zone defense, the top defender is on the basketball and the two wings are protecting the free-throw line and allowing the pass to be made to the wing.
